Главная /
Common Intermediate Language и системное программирование в Microsoft .NET /
В данном случае:ov.Offset = 12345; if ( WriteFile( fh, buffer, sizeof(buffer), &dwWritten, &ov ) || GetLastError() == ERROR_IO_PENDING ) { while (!GetOverlappedResult(fh, &ov, &dwWritten, FALSE)){} } else { }Функция GetOverlappedResult про
В данном случае:ov.Offset = 12345;
if (
WriteFile( fh, buffer, sizeof(buffer), &dwWritten, &ov ) ||
GetLastError() == ERROR_IO_PENDING
) {
while (!GetOverlappedResult(fh, &ov, &dwWritten, FALSE)){}
} else {
} Функция GetOverlappedResult
проверяет:
вопрос
Правильный ответ:
состояние операции ввода-вывода и возвращает признак ее завершения
состояние операции вывода и возвращает признак ее завершения
состояние операции ввода и возвращает признак ее завершения
состояние операции ввода-вывода и возвращает признак ее исполнения
Сложность вопроса
89
Сложность курса: Common Intermediate Language и системное программирование в Microsoft .NET
76
Оценить вопрос
Комментарии:
Аноним
Это очень нехитрый вопрос intuit.
02 май 2019
Аноним
Если бы не эти ответы - я бы не смог решить c этими тестами intuit.
29 май 2017
Аноним
Большое спасибо за тесты по intuit.
17 мар 2017
Другие ответы на вопросы из темы программирование интуит.
- # Разработка платформы .NET началась в:
- # Для ограничения числа потоков, имеющих одновременный доступ к какому-либо ресурсу предназначены:
- # Средствами взаимной синхронизации потоков в .NET являются:
- # VES является значительно более абстрактной моделью, чем:
- # Алгоритмы, работающие неизвестно сколько времени и потребляющие неизвестно какое количество ресурсов, представляют скорее: